Industrial gutter repair services focus on maintaining and restoring the functionality of large-scale gutter systems typically found in commercial, industrial, and multi-unit properties. These services involve inspecting, repairing, and sometimes replacing sections of gutters, downspouts, and related components to ensure proper water flow and prevent damage. Technicians assess issues such as leaks, corrosion, sagging, and blockages, providing targeted solutions to restore the integrity of the entire gutter system. Proper repair helps extend the lifespan of gutters and maintains the overall protection of the building’s structure.

Addressing common problems like leaks, rust, and sagging gutters, these services help prevent water damage to the building’s foundation, walls, and roofing. Blocked or damaged gutters can lead to overflowing water, which may cause erosion, mold growth, and structural deterioration over time. Repairing these issues promptly ensures that rainwater is effectively diverted away from the property, reducing the risk of costly repairs and maintaining the property's value. Properly functioning gutters also contribute to the safety of the property by minimizing water pooling and potential slip hazards.

The overview below groups typical Industrial Gutter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oconee County, SC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- Full gutter replacements typically range from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on gutter size and material. For example, replacing a standard 50-foot gutter system might cost around $2,500.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ific property needs.

Repair Expenses - Minor repairs such as fixing leaks or replacing sections often cost between $150 and $600. Larger repairs or extensive damage can increase costs up to $1,200 or more. Costs vary based on the extent of the damage and gutter type.

Material Costs - The price of materials like aluminum, vinyl, or copper influences overall costs. Aluminum gutters generally range from $3 to $5 per linear foot, while copper can cost $15 or more per foot. Material choice impacts both initial costs and longevity.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for gutter repair services typically range from $50 to $150 per hour. Total labor costs depend on the project scope, with larger jobs taking longer and costing more. Local service providers can offer detailed estimates based on specific rep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my industrial gutters need repair? Signs include leaks, sagging sections, rust, or water overflowing during rainstorms. If any of these are observed, contacting a local gutter repair professional is recommended.

What types of repairs are common for industrial gutters? Common repairs include sealing leaks, replacing damaged sections, fixing sagging areas, and clearing blockages to ensure proper drainage.

How long does industrial gutter repair usually take? Repair durations vary depending on the extent of damage but are typically completed within a few hours to a day after assessment by a local contractor.

Are there maintenance services available for industrial gutters? Yes, many service providers offer regular inspections, cleaning, and maintenance to help prevent future issues.
